I am looking for assistance to configure my pair of FTDs devices ( 2100 ) in HA using Ether Channel.
I have already added my both FTDs in FMC, I have configured Ether Channels on both FTDs via Device Managament but when i try to add/configure HA for both FTDs then i am unable to see/select Etherchannel from the interface option.

Yes.
Please create the port-channel without any logical name or zone, add the physical interfaces that you want to bundle in it and after that you would be able to use port-channel in the HA.
